We accidentally had the SandBox mode on in our WooCommerce shop. The customer received a delayed order confirmation and has now paid his order to the SandBox with real credentials. The checkout is complete in WooCommerce. The transaction number of the PayPal payment is stored in the developer account in the events as a log entry. What now? Has the customer really paid? Do we have to set up the SandBox user again to trigger a refund? It's very confusing at the moment. I thought a sandbox can't receive real money? Of course, the customer also thinks he has paid.

Thank you for posting to the PayPal Sandbox Community. Sandbox is a virtual environment, so the buyer's funding source was not  charged. Since Sandbox is a virtual environment, and used for simulating payments, the buyer will never see any funds being removed from their funding source.

If you would like you can refund the sandbox payment by logging into your sandbox account at https://sandbox.paypal.com, click on activity, click on the transaction and choose to refund the payment. The refund will be a virtual refund.

I would recommend re-integrating your shopping cart and pointing to live, to ensure that you receive live payments.
